I think you must mean this dialog:

Possible actions:
1: abort (with core dump, if enabled)
2: normal R exit
3: exit R without saving workspace
4: exit R saving workspace
> 
Selection: 

It’s not a nice thing to see. It means that R has crashed. You choose one of those items by typing a number between 1 and 4 and then “return”.
